>   r_offset
>   This member gives the location at which to apply the relocation action. For a relocatable file, the value is the byte offset from the beginning of the section to the storage unit affected by the relocation. For an executable file or a shared object, the value is the virtual address of the storage unit affected by the relocation.
>
> This shows that the assertion is incorrect, as the ELF ABI suggests reading relocation records is valid in Executables as well.
>
> While relocation offset is not looked up for shared libraries from .rela.dyn and .rela.plt sections, there is a usecase where relocation sections are generated with the linker switch **--emit-relocs**
>
> Removing the assertion, LGTM.
